Output 33b724bae721552fe652583365fcb8489a947228aac5f717f81f3cf266ff8a9a:38

value
620696
script pubkey
OP_0 OP_PUSHBYTES_20 4632a56497eef04918bf66821d47bb626ecdb038
address
bc1qgce22eyhamcyjx9lv6pp63amvfhvmvpcggvj0h
transaction
33b724bae721552fe652583365fcb8489a947228aac5f717f81f3cf266ff8a9a
spent
true